Former MA Journalism Studies student Helena Hong Liang tells us about working in Formula One GP and preparing for the 2008 Beijing Olympic Games.

Course Studied: MA Journalism Studies

Graduation Year: 2000

Current Employer: APCO Worldwide, Shanghai Office

Position: Senior Consultant

Briefly describe your current position.
I am currently responsible for corporate communication and media strategy, and provide ongoing communication consultancy to a number of major multinational clients.

What is the best thing about your current position?
Most recently, I was a senior account manager of the corporate communication practice of Edelman Beijing. I planned and implemented communication programs to maximize the value of the clients’ sponsorship of the Beijing 2008 Olympic Games, including Johnson & Johnson, VW and Audi.

I also provided support to the public affairs practice, particularly for clients in the financial industry. Prior to my time with Edelman, I was with Powell Tate | Weber Shandwick Beijing.

How well did your JOMEC education prepare you for your current position?
During my studies at JOMEC/Cardiff, I obtained my first professional job to be an onsite TV reporter for Formula One GP which it’s a great opportunity to open my eyes/mind, and become a professional journalist.

What did you enjoy most about studying here?
Nice tutors, interesting course and a nice/friendly place to study.

Why did you choose JOMEC/Cardiff as a place to study?

I was an inter working at China Central TV Station (CCTV) in 1997 when Mr. Tim Westlake visited News Centre and delivered a presentation about JOMEC and Cardiff there. I was attracted by his presentation, and decided to choose JOMEC/Cardiff for my further education.
